    Default Link to file in password protected sub folder

    Hello all, I am a new member to the forum but have been viewing your posts here over time to help me learn more about Web Designer. Thank you. However I do now have a situation where I am unable to find a previous thread that is pointing me in the right direction.

    I would like to create links on a client support page where they can download various .exe files and not for general public pdf's. I will store the .exe & pdf files in a password protected folder on the webhost server.

    How do I link to these files in that protected folder using Web Designer 11?

    As I understand it, WD includes copies of linked files in the index_htm_files folder but that is not what I want for this situation as the .exe & pdf files can only reside in the protected folder.

    Any help to point me in the right direction would be greatly appreciated.

    Default Re: Link to file in password protected sub folder

    What I do is create a folder using filezilla, upload the files into it, and password protect the folder using my host's control panel.
    I then link to the files from the website.
    When you click a link, it will bring up a password box.

    Default Re: Link to file in password protected sub folder

    Thanks Merlin, that is exactly what I want to do.

    However I was trying to put the file address in the wrong box of the web properties dialogue box. Tried to put it in "link to file" instead of "link to web", my error.

    Now working like it should.
